본문 바로가기

Network

TCP와 UDP 비교

반응형
구분 TCP(transmission control protocol) UDP(user datagram protocol)
연결 방식 연결성(CO: connection-oriented) 방식 비연결성(CL: connectionless) 방식
End-to-end 사이에 발생할 수 있는 문제 순서 제어, 에러 제어, 혼잡 제어, 흐름 제어 있음 ➩ 신뢰성 있는 데이터 전송 순서 제어, 에러 제어, 혼잡 제어, 흐름 제어가 없음 ➩ 신뢰성 없는 데이터 전송
네트워크 상태 안 좋을 때 사용(WAN에서 사용) 좋을 때 사용(LAN에서 사용)
전송 거리 길 때 사용 짧을 때 사용
전송할 데이터의 양 길고 많은 양의 데이터를 안정적으로 전송할 때 유리 짧고 적은 양의 데이터를 전송할 때 유리
실시간 데이터 불리 유리
• 에러를 허용하는 데이터
• 재전송하면 안되는 데이터(실시간 음성, 동영상)

연결성 서비스 VS 비연결성 서비스

 

연결성 서비스와 비연결성 서비스 비교, 장단점

연결성(CO) 서비스 VS 비연결성(CL) 서비스상황전송 방식전송할 데이터 길 때 / 많을 때CO 방식전송할 데이터 짧을 때 / 적을 때CL 방식네트워크 상태가 좋을 때 (예: LAN)CL 방식네트워크 상태가 좋지

my-april.tistory.com

 

반응형

'Network' 카테고리의 다른 글

연결성 서비스와 비연결성 서비스 비교  (0) 2025.04.02